My Students

"Do not let what you cannot do interfere with what you can do," John Weldon said, and this is what I want my students to live by each and every day. I would like for my students to have a love of reading novels and experience new things through that love.

My students are from a diverse background.

The neighborhood that they come from is a very tough one, however, my students come to school each day ready to work and with an open mind. I appreciate them greatly!!! Many of my students are faced with situations that normally do not occur until later in life. My students are those who learn the value of perseverance early in life.

My Project

When my students receive "The Mis-Education of the Negro" by Carter Godwin Woodson, we will study this novel so that they know they are capable of doing so much more in life. I would like for all my students to understand that their futures depends on how they react to present situations. Education is the key to success. It is not about money or material things. The students will organize a presentation to the class to reveal what they learned from the novel study.

When my students read this book, my goal is to facilitate a mindset of never giving up.

I want them to realize their future is in their hands. Each student should realize they are in control of themselves and not anyone else. This generation is so used to having every thing handed to them, that they do not realize that history is repeating itself. We are still slaves to society and how it wants us to act.
